Existe uma maneira barata de começar com os chips GAL (Generic Array Logic)?

10

Os chips GAL parecem caros para começar, pois os programadores custam centenas de dólares e até os cabos ISP não são baratos.

Existe uma maneira mais barata?

samoz
fonte
4
Eu sempre ouvi isso renderizado como "Gate Array Logic". "Generic Array Logic" é novo para mim.
Connor Lobo
2
pt.wikipedia.org/wiki/Generic_array_logic Era assim que eles sempre os chamavam nas minhas aulas de EE.
samoz

Respostas:

5

Eu nem tenho certeza de que as GALs ainda estão por aí hoje. Creio que os CPLDs e FPGAs são os preferidos, embora não seja especialista. Você pode desenterrar kits de desenvolvimento em digilentinc.com. Há um kit de CPLD por US $ 18 e o cabo de programação USB JTAG é de US $ 50. Essas peças são Digilent C-Mod e JTAG-USB Cable. Eu acredito que o software (pelo menos o software inicial) é gratuito. Boa sorte!

AngryEE
fonte
3
Só acho um pouco ridículo que os programadores sejam mais do que o dobro do kit em si.
samoz
Chips são baratos. Bem, os cabos devem ser baratos, mas há um pouco de inteligência no cabo. E é proprietário. Então, sim, é um pouco ridículo.
precisa saber é o seguinte
Se os chips são baratos, use um cpld para criar um programador cpld ... publicado como uma piada, mas é isso que você encontrará em muitos deles. Geralmente, os USB são um FT245 e o mesmo CPLD usado anteriormente na versão paralela.
Chris Stratton
4

Aqui está o esquema de um PCB caseiro simples para experimentar com os CPLDs Xilinx XC9536. Possui um conector para um cabo de programação Xilinx, um soquete para um oscilador de cristal e um LED, além de uma pequena área de prototipagem. O arquivo de arte está disponível.

Leon Heller
fonte
4

As GALs padrão precisam de tensões e formas de onda descoladas para programação. A Lattice faz alguns produtos 'ispGAL' que adicionam uma interface IS, mas, a menos que você queira usar DILs e / ou 5V, os CPLDs low-end são mais capazes e fáceis de programar.

mikeselectricstuff
fonte